PUT
put 은 클라이언트가 리소스의 위치를 알고 식별함.
post는 리소스를 클라이언트가 식별불가.
100번에 있는 리소스가 전송하는 순간 50이 20을 덮어버리는 것을 알 수 있다.
기존 리소스를 지우고 새롭게 리소스를 올리는 것.(예시에서 서버의 username이 날라갔음)
(기존 것의 수정이 어려움) -> PATCH 사용.
PATCH
기존 리소스 부분수정(서버의 username이 살아있음.)
DELETE
리소스 제거
HTTP 메서드의 속성
출처: 모든 개발자를 위한 HTTP 웹 기본 지식(김영한)
'📋CS > 네트워크 이론' 카테고리의 다른 글
Cors와 Proxy (0) | 2024.06.06 |
---|---|
쿠키, 토큰 JWT, 세션 간단 정리+ JWT 실습 (0) | 2024.02.13 |
HTTP(3)[http 메서드 get, post] (0) | 2023.09.21 |
HTTP(2)[http의 리소스 다루기] (0) | 2023.09.20 |
HTTP(1)[비연결성, 메시지] (0) | 2023.09.19 |